THE PROMISE OF GOOD THINGS TO COME

To our great relief, Homer Simpson is a unique breed of person. But it A turns out he’s an even more unusual manager.

In our initial visits with corporate leaders across America, we frequently ask how many managers within their corporations actively recognize their workers.

“Maybe 10 to 20 percent,” most CEOs reply.

That means if you are recognizing, you’ve got a strategic advantage over 80 to 90 percent of the managers in your company. Make the most of it. Be different. Be innovative. With recognition. (And, come to think of it, a few strategically placed donuts might not be such a bad idea, either.)
